Position Assistant Professor Year Joined ISU 2005 Expertise and Activity Statement Carl is an assistant professor in the Department of Political Science. He earned a BA from the University of Nebraska at Lincoln, an MA from the University of California at Davis, and a Ph.D. from Texas A&M University. His research interests include campaigns and elections, state politics, and welfare policy, especially as these three subjects pertain to political and social inequality and reform. His most recent work is with election forecasting models applied to the 2006 and 2008 House and Senate elections as well as the 2008 presidential election. His classes emphasize modern Political Science approaches which are often informed by the results of statistical studies.
